INTERNAL MEMO — Branch Managers

Project Larkspur, our inventory reconciliation initiative, has slipped a further six weeks due to integration issues between the Veldin warehouse module and our legacy ledger. The revised cutover now targets late Q3. Please hold staff training until the new schedule is confirmed by the Tarnow office. We are aware this affects branch planning cycles, and we appreciate your patience. Please treat the following note as strictly confidential.

board note of kageg-bahof: The renewal with Holwynax Holdings closes at $2 million a year, 5 percent below the last contract. Project Ulaath slips by two quarters because of the supplier delay.

## v3.8.2 — Fixed memory leak in thumbnail cache

For new team members: the Orrin Gallery image cache held strong references to decoded bitmaps after eviction, causing steady heap growth under long browsing sessions. The cache now uses weak references for evicted entries and trims on memory-pressure signals. Heap usage in soak tests dropped by roughly 40%. If you see related regressions, flag them to the cache component owner, named below.

account owner for bawip-tahag: Raleth Quenok

// MAX_POOL_CONNECTIONS — support, read this before touching it.
// Governs the Thornlake API's shared pool against the Veldt cluster.
// Raising it past 40 starves the batch workers; lowering it below 12
// causes checkout timeouts under normal evening load. If customers
// report "pool exhausted" errors, check for leaked connections in the
// export job first — it's been the culprit every time so far.
// Any change here needs a restart of all four app nodes, in order.
// Changes ship tagged with the build token recorded below.

build token for yajof-bajof: htk31_506ff1188f74596b5bb2eec94edc43c